探索Github中文社区:开发者的开放平台

引言

在当今的互联网时代,Github已经成为开发者进行代码管理和协作的重要平台。尤其是Github中文社区,它为广大的中国开发者提供了一个良好的交流与合作环境。本文将深入探讨Github中文社区的现状、发展、参与方式及其对开发者的意义。

Github中文社区的概述

Github中文社区是指在Github平台上,使用中文进行交流、分享和合作的开发者群体。这个社区包含了众多开源项目、技术分享以及开发者之间的互动。

Github中文社区的发展历程

  • 2010年代初:Github在中国逐渐受到关注,早期的用户主要是一些技术爱好者。
  • 2015年:随着中国互联网行业的发展,Github中文社区开始快速成长。
  • 近几年:越来越多的高校、企业和个人开发者开始在Github上发布和分享项目,形成了一个活跃的生态圈。

Github中文社区的重要性

  • 开源文化的推广:Github中文社区助力了开源文化在中国的传播。
  • 技术交流:提供了一个方便的技术交流平台,促进了知识共享。
  • 项目合作:方便开发者之间的合作,提升了开发效率。

如何参与Github中文社区

参与Github中文社区是一个简单而有效的方式来融入开发者生态。以下是一些参与的步骤和建议:

1. 注册Github账号

首先,您需要在Github网站上注册一个账号。注册后,您可以创建自己的项目、关注其他开发者以及参与开源项目。

2. 加入中文社区组织

许多中文开发者组织和团队在Github上活跃。加入这些组织能够帮助您与更多的开发者建立联系。

3. 参与开源项目

  • 查找感兴趣的项目:使用Github的搜索功能,查找您感兴趣的开源项目。
  • 提交PR(Pull Request):参与项目的开发,通过提交PR来贡献代码。
  • 报告问题:帮助维护者报告项目中的问题,以促进项目的改进。

4. 分享自己的项目

  • 创建仓库:在Github上创建自己的项目仓库,记录您的开发过程。
  • 编写文档:清晰的项目文档可以帮助他人更好地理解您的项目。
  • 宣传推广:通过社交媒体和技术社区宣传您的项目,吸引更多用户参与。

Github中文社区的特色

在Github中文社区中,有许多独特的元素,帮助开发者更好地交流与合作。

1. 中文文档与教程

许多开源项目在Github上提供中文文档,使得更多开发者能够轻松上手。这些文档通常包括:

  • 安装说明
  • 使用示例
  • API参考

2. 线下活动

Github中文社区定期举办线下活动,例如开发者大会、技术分享会等。这些活动为开发者提供了面对面交流的机会,促进了合作。

3. 社交媒体的结合

许多开发者会通过社交媒体(如微博、微信等)分享自己的Github项目和经验,形成了线上线下互动的良好氛围。

常见问题解答(FAQ)

Github中文社区是否有专门的论坛或平台?

是的,许多开发者在各种社交媒体和论坛上建立了讨论小组,例如微信群、QQ群等,以便于更便捷的沟通。

如何找到合适的开源项目参与?

您可以通过Github的“Explore”功能,查找标签为“中文”或“中文社区”的项目,筛选出适合您的项目。

参与开源项目需要具备什么样的技能?

虽然参与开源项目的技能要求不尽相同,但一般来说,掌握基本的编程语言和版本控制工具(如Git)是必要的。

Github中文社区的项目质量如何?

许多优秀的项目都在Github中文社区中发布,其中不乏在技术领域内具备重要影响力的项目,质量相对较高。

如何更好地与其他开发者合作?

  • 维护良好的沟通:使用评论和Issue功能与其他开发者交流。
  • 及时反馈:对其他开发者的贡献给予积极的反馈。

结论

Github中文社区作为一个开放、包容的开发者平台,为众多中国开发者提供了展示自我的机会,也为技术的交流与合作搭建了桥梁。通过积极参与这一社区,开发者不仅能提升自己的技术水平,也能为整个技术生态贡献力量。希望本文能帮助您更好地理解和参与Github中文社区,让我们一起在这个开放的平台上共同进步。

正文完